Different tune


Star Soprano...Charlotte Church

Teenage singing sensation Charlotte Church wants to try something different. But she's not sure what. I don't want to go too far away from what I'm doing now because that would alienate my audience said Church who was in Athens recently to perform a charity concert. "I'm not really sure where I'm heading with my music, she said. But I do want to try and do something a bit unique. I need to expand". Church said that although she naturally leaned toward classical music, she liked mixing musical sounds, such as classical and rhythm and blues. "I really like breaking down musical barriers".
